On Fri, May 28, 2010 at 09:16:31AM -0700, Guenter Roeck wrote:

> does anyone know if there is an effort to add infrastructure for PMBus
> support (or support for specific PMBus devices) to Linux ?

I found this:

http://lists.lm-sensors.org/pipermail/lm-sensors/2008-April/022969.html

Hmm, sitting ontop of SMBus, it makes perfect sense to use i2c-dev (David knows
what he is doing, of course ;)). But having no repo and all, it is hard to
maintain this utility. Is there any chance to pick it up in the kernel-tree?
tools/i2c/ or such? Hmm, it's GPL v3...
